    I have the Vistoft rug since about 2,5 years and after furnishing the whole room brand new I can say that this was THE item that was most worth it! It looks absolutely incredible, feels nice and is suuuuper easy to maintain. Highly recommend this to anyone. It is quite a heavy quality and I feel like I will be taking this from place to place for maybe even for more than a decade. Did not expect that for the affordable pricepoint.
